Betty Louise Craven Watson-Robson, age 77, of Asheboro passed away on Thursday, October 29, 2020 at Randolph Hospice House.
Betty was born in Randolph County on March 25, 1943 to Ira and Annie Hoover Craven. She loved to make pottery and was the owner/operator of Shapes of Clay Pottery. Betty was a member of West Asheboro Baptist Church. In addition to her parents, Betty was preceded in death by her first husband, Jerry Giles Watson, Sr., her son, Jerry Giles Watson, Jr., and her sister, Clara Gatlin. Betty loved to cook, especially for other people, and put together two cookbooks. Betty had a good sense of humor.
She is survived by her husband, Robert "Bob" Neal Robson; daughters, Robin Watson and Wendy Watson both of Asheboro; son, Rodney Todd of South Carolina; granddaughter, Alecia Benware and husband Brandon of Asheboro; great grandchildren, Asher and Hazel Benware; cousin, Larry Craven; niece, Susan Beasley, and nephew, Barry Gatlin.
A celebration of Betty's life will be held at a later date.
